I am trying to track down a problem which may or may not be courier-imap, but I would appreciate some help to further isolate it.
Setup: client and server on same system. MUA is Sylpheed-claws 0.8.5, Courier-imap 1.5.1, Gentoo Linux. Problem: intermittently (about 50% failure rate) trying to move or copy mails from one folder to another results in the mail not being copied. Tests, client: have traced this right through Sylpheed-claws, which appears to be issuing the correct UID COPY command and getting "OK" back from the server. Test, server: set up a debug file. One unsuccessful copy was initiated and showed this in the log: READ: NUMBER: 473 READ: ATOM: UID READ: ATOM: COPY READ: NUMBER: 3457 READ: ATOM: INBOX.Scratch.sc1 READ: EOL WRITE: 473 OK COPY completed. This would appear to indicate that the mail was copied, but it wasn't. I would be grateful if anyone could offer any suggestions as to how to proceed from here in trying to resolve this.
